Overview
If you’re short on time but want to see more than just the Portuguese capital, this full-day tour takes you to three cities in just one day. Depart Lisbon and head to the medieval walled city of Obidos and the fishing town of Nazare for brief walking tours. Then, head up to Portugal’s second city, Porto, for a guided tour of its UNESCO-listed town center.
